just curious, ive seen some 3 1/2s that are like 20-25w rms

i was just wondering if u powered them off a hu with 20-25w rms would u b able to tell a diff (cleaner sound) with an amp pushing 20-25w? or does it come down to a watt is a watt??

 
It depends on the amp and h/u. Most likely, there will be little or no audible difference at a moderate volume level. At an extremely high volume level the amp would run much cleaner with less distortion.

 
I've blown out 2 sets of 3-1/2's with just head unit power, even the Kappa's that supposedly take 35 watts. It's the bass that kills them. Need bass-blockers on those little guys. An amp with adjustable hipass would let you get them as loud as possible without damaging them. I run mine with series resistors now to limit their power.

 
I also blew a pair a infinty kappa's just from headunit power.(kenwood headunit) but i loved the infinity's so i replaced them with the exact same pair but put in bass blockers(its not like ur gonna miss out on alot of bass from 3 1/2's) The pair i have now sound great, esp with the highs. U dont need an amp for 3 1/2's less u got some extra money.
